Verdict

The Nikon NIKKOR Z 800mm f/6.3 VR S is a high-performance super-telephoto prime lens designed for the Z-mount system, featuring a Phase Fresnel (PF) element that allows it to be remarkably lightweight at approximately 2,385g and 16% shorter than its predecessor. Key specifications include a specialized 5.0-stop Vibration Reduction (VR) system (up to 5.5-stops with Synchro VR), a fast Stepping Motor (STM) for quiet autofocus, and a professional build with weather sealing and a fluorine coating. Its primary pros are its incredible portability for handheld wildlife and sports photography, exceptional S-line optical sharpness, and a competitive price point compared to traditional f/5.6 exotic primes. However, notable cons include a relatively narrow f/6.3 maximum aperture that may require higher ISOs in low light, a long minimum focusing distance of 5 metres, and potential for busy background bokeh or ring flare in specific backlighting situations.

What customers like about Nikon NIKKOR Z 800mm F 6 3 VR S?

  • Remarkably lightweight and compact for an 800mm lens due to Phase Fresnel (PF) technology
  • Significantly more affordable than previous F-mount 800mm f/5.6 versions
  • Excellent image sharpness and optical performance even when used wide open
  • Fast, accurate, and quiet autofocus performance suitable for wildlife and sports
  • Highly effective 5-stop Vibration Reduction (VR) that enables handheld shooting
  • Advanced build quality with robust weather sealing and fluorine coating

What customers dislike about Nikon NIKKOR Z 800mm F 6 3 VR S?

  • Maximum aperture of f/6.3 is slower than elite primes, potentially requiring higher ISO in low light
  • Phase Fresnel (PF) element can produce distracting ring flare or reduced contrast in strong backlight
  • Long minimum focusing distance (approx. 5m/16ft) can be restrictive for close subjects
  • Bokeh can appear 'busy' or nervous, especially with complex backgrounds like grass
  • The included lens hood is exceptionally large and can make the setup cumbersome to store
  • Tripod foot is not Arca-Swiss compatible, often requiring a replacement plate
  • Noticeable focus breathing may be an issue for serious video work
